Lawrence of Arabia is a British film based on the life of T. E. Lawrence and
his experiences in Arabia during World War l. It is considered to be one of
the greatest and most influential films in the history of cinema with a highly
acclaimed score by Maurice Jarre and cinematography by Freddie Young.

OSCAR FOR BEST PICTURE IN 1959
The epic film Ben-Hur was the most expensive ever made at the time, with sets the
largest yet built for a movie. The films nine-minute chariot race is the most famous
sequences in cinema history. The score is the longest ever composed for a motion
picture.

RECORDED ON THIS DAY IN1937
"Sweet Leilani" was featured in the 1937 film, Waikiki Wedding. It
won the Academy Award for Best Original Song, and Bing Crosby’s
record became one of the biggest hits of the year.
Harry Owens wrote the song on October 20, 1934 for his daughter
Leilani, who was born the previous day. Leilani is a popular
Hawaiian name, meaning "heavenly garland of flowers".
